SHOOT LIKE A PRO

Top-notch tips that will enhance your action-packed portfolio

1 Get it right in-camera

Continuously adjust exposure settings as light conditions change, so you’re always ready.

2 Back-button focus

Dedicate a back button on the rear of your Canon camera, usually the AF-ON button, to lock focus quicker, and prevent hunting. Plus it leaves half-pressing the shutter button to metering.

3 Find a new perspective

Seek out interesting angles, like a top-down view of a pirouetting ballerina or a low-angle shot of a diving keeper from behind the goal.

4 Freeze the decisive moment

A last-minute winning goal or first-place finishline celebration are more compelling than a consolation goal or mid-pack athlete’s finish.

5 Know your subject

Research your subject, and you’ll begin to anticipate movements.

Best kit advice

These tools will help you keep up with fleeting moments of action sports

6 Use fast lenses to blur backgrounds

Fast lenses are an action essential. They boast wider apertures, which makes it easier to isolate subjects with shallower depths of field, and gather more light, so you can maintain faster shutter speeds in lower lighting conditions.
